## v3.8.0 — Tracing

- Added end-to-end request tracing across all Lanternmesh microservices; spans now propagate through the queue workers.
- Trace sampling raised to 10% in staging, 1% in production.
- Fixed span loss on retried gateway calls.
- Deprecated the legacy correlation-header shim; removal slated for v4.0.
- Release notes must reference the tracing migration guide before sign-off. Questions on trace schema changes go to the engineer named below.

account owner for bawip-tahag: Raleth Quenok

Handover Note — Marketing Budget

From T. Averell to S. Doyen, Calindra Foods. Q3 marketing spend cut by 22% effective month-end. Sponsorships in Westmoor region cancelled; digital campaigns for the Pelora range paused. Branch managers must hold local spend to approved floors only. No exceptions without Doyen's sign-off. The reasoning behind the cut is summarised in the confidential note below.

confidential, kagap-yagef: The finance team signed off on a budget of $467.8 million for Project Aldok.

Key ceremony checklist — Thornbay build fleet. Before signing, verify clock skew across all build agents is under 30 seconds; skewed agents invalidate ceremony timestamps. Quorum of three custodians required. If any custodian token fails due to skew, fall back to the sealed recovery flow. That flow prompts for the passphrase recorded here:

unlock words, hahip-baduf: holwyn-istath-julvan